They did that here at first. Whenever a vehicle was sold as used, it had to
be retro-fitted to pass the current smog certs. My 1970 Firebird had a
do-dad on it to shut off the vacuum advance and the ignition was retarded to
0ø crankshaft. I removed it and went to a smog station. The guy told me he
couldn't test it, since it wasn't retro-fitted with that gadget. I told him
I was the original owner, then he agreed to test it.
